Super User scaleface Posted August 11, 2021 Super User Posted August 11, 2021 The one on the left is a Bomber Prop A .A Long A minnow with a prop . The largest limit of bass I have ever caught was on one . Its one of my favorite post spawn baits When they were discontinued I found some in a clearance bin and bought a bunch of them . I have never used that pattern but by the looks of them , they caught a fair number of bass . They were not around long and absolutely zero information about them on the internet . My favorite retrieve is to twitch as fast as I can , yet still remain in contact with the surface . 2 Quote
